Overview
The British Council in Mumbai is offering an opportunity to join as a Deputy Director Arts. This role is central to supporting peace and prosperity by fostering UK-India cultural connections. The successful candidate will work on mid-scale multi-year programs, mentor India’s Arts Programme Managers, and manage a diverse portfolio across digital and physical platforms.
Role Purpose
The Deputy Director Arts will lead key initiatives, including Culture Connects and Creative Economy, to create impactful arts programs. This position involves deputising for the Director Arts, managing program portfolios, and representing the British Council at significant arts events. A critical aspect of this role is to ensure a cohesive national program that adds value to UK-India cultural relations.
